Birds often visit in an instant. Kiwibit 2 Pro’s Auto-Focus automatically adjusts the camera’s focus to help keep them clear as they perch, feed, hover, or fly, so you can enjoy more of the action at your feeder in Live View and recorded videos.
1. What Is Auto-Focus?
Auto-Focus is a built-in feature available on Kiwibit 2 Pro. It continuously adjusts the camera’s focus to help keep the image clear as birds move.
When you open Live View, Auto-Focus prioritizes the area around the feeder. This helps bring visiting birds into clearer view more quickly and reduce focus distractions from background objects, such as distant branches or scenery.
2. No Setup Required
Auto-Focus is enabled by default on Kiwibit 2 Pro. You do not need to turn it on or adjust any focus settings in the Kiwibit app.
Simply use your Kiwibit 2 Pro as usual, and the camera will automatically adjust focus to help provide a clearer view of visiting birds.
